NB Bank coordinates with its mother bank in Bangladesh for COVID response; to bring Rs 2.25 crore worth critical medical supply from Bangladesh to support Nepal fight against Coronavirus

Fri, Aug 28, 2020 7:14 AM on Latest, Corporate,

Nepal Bangladesh Bank, under its CSR initiative, has begun a process to provide five thousand piece RENDESIVIR worth Rs 2.25 crore, a drug that is deemed quite critical in treating the COVID 19  patients.

The bank has arranged for such a critical supply of the medicine through a coordinated effort of its mother bank IFIC Bank in Bangladesh, as per the media statement.

The bank has already provided financial support of Rs 1.45 crore to the different tiers of government in Nepal to support their fight against COVID, as per the media statement.
